Inflation remains a pressing concern for many economies worldwide. As prices soar, central banks often turn to interest rate hikes as a key mechanism to stem inflation's growth.

  • Increasing interest rates, central banks aim to make borrowing more expensive. This can reduce consumer and business spending, which in turn can slow down inflation.
  • However, interest rate hikes can also have unintended consequences for economic growth. A sharp increase in rates can lead to a recession.

Therefore, central banks must judiciously calibrate interest rate increases to achieve a balance between limiting inflationary pressures and supporting economic growth.

The Cost of Being Female: Combating the Pink Tax During Inflation

Inflation is hitting everyone hard, but for women, the impact can be particularly acute. This is due in part to the persistent "Pink Tax," a phenomenon where products marketed towards women are often priced higher than comparable products for men. From razors and shampoo to clothing and haircuts, women are consistently laying out more for everyday essentials simply because they are labeled as feminine. While it might seem like a small variation, these added costs escalate over time, creating a significant financial disparity for women.
